As you can see based on Table 3, our data is perfectly ordered in respect to the second … WebIn R, these tables can be created using table () along with some of its variations. To use table (), simply add in the variables you want to tabulate separated by a comma. Note that table () does not have a data= argument like many other functions do (e.g., ggplot2 functions), so you much reference the variable using dataset$variable.

WebAug 10, 2024 · How to change the order of columns in an R data frame? R Programming Server Side Programming Programming Ordering columns might be required when we … WebAnother alternative for changing the order of variables is provided by the subset function of the base installation of R. We can apply the subset function as follows: subset ( data, select = c (2, 1, 3)) # Reorder columns with subset () Again, the same output. WebIn data.table parlance, all set* functions change their input by reference. That is, no copy is made at all, other than temporary working memory, which is as large as one column. The only other data.table operator that modifies input by reference is := . Check out the See Also section below for other set* function data.table provides.
